Dubai
Dubai is slowly climbing up the ladders of
being a world-class destination. Complete and redefine your shopping experience
with world-class malls like the Dubai Mall, the Mall of the Emirates, and much
more. For more authentic shopping experiences, you can head to the boutique or
designer stores at Jumeirah road. For the best variety and prices on the yellow
metal or other precious stones, head to the Gold Souk. Shopping in Dubai can be
a wonderful experience considering the options and variety available at your
disposal. The once in a year shopping festival in Dubai is the biggest shopping sale in the world which offers up to 75% discount.

11. Milan
Fashion comes synonymous with Milan. There
are several brands such as Armani, Prada, Gucci, Missoni, Luis Vuitton, and
Versace that have flagship stores in Milan. The Galleria Vittorio Emanuele is
one of the oldest shopping malls in Italy, which was launched in the year 1877.
This place oozes with brands, brands, and more brands, one of the most
delightful places to shop around.

14. Austin
The Texas capital is home to several
independent boutiques and stores which house local as well as numerous vintage
brands. For checking out some classic Texas fashion labels, head to Allens
Boots, which offers an irresistible collection of authentic cowboy boots.
